Traditional clothes in high demand at NERCORMP exhibition
Source: The Sangai Express / Mungchan Zimik
Ukhrul, November 27 2015 :
Traditional clothes, specially indigenously woven women wear, were in high demand during the three day NERCORMP exhibition cum sale mela at Ukhrul.
According to them in three days, sellers of the indigenous women clothes earned over Rs 2 lakh.
Even though vegetables were in high demand, their sale proceeds could not match the other items.
The Programme Manager of UDCRMS/IFAD, Ukhrul Tychicus Vashum declared the 9th NERCORMP Exhibition cum Sale closed today.
Earlier , before the closing programme the three day sales proceeds from all the stalls were announced and it was a handsome Rs 17.45 lakh.
Kamtha cluster, Shomi SHG and Chirmi SHG federation were adjudged the Ist, 2nd and 3rd spot winners of the 9th NERCORMP Exhibition cum Sale.
During a brief interaction some of the farmers said the exhibition cum sale programme was very beneficial for them because they managed to gain some knowledge on marketing within a short period of time.
